Analysis of Students' Mathematical Problem Solving Ability in Solving HOTS Problems in terms of Mathematical Resilience
This research purposed to describe students' mathematical problem solving abilities in solving HOTS questions based on mathematical resilience. This type of research is descriptive qualitative research with the subjects of this study were class VII students, totaling 218 students who were selected by purposive sampling. The research subjects were grouped into 3 categories based on mathematical resilience: high, medium, and low. The instrument used is a mathematical resilience questionnaire, a written test of mathematical problem solving ability, and an interview. This study indicates that from 115 students, there are 8 students with low mathematical resilience category, 79 students with medium mathematical resilience category, and 28 students with high mathematical resilience category. Some students are in the category of moderate mathematical resilience. And each high, medium and low category has different mathematical problem solving abilities in solving HOTS questions.
